    Quote Originally Posted by ghz1
    How do you know that Raven?
    Mike V said it himself after all the E errors were happening:
    Quote Originally Posted by MikeV
    the recent software version changes have been the result of our fine tuning to match subtle variations in some parts supplied by our vendors.
    Parts supplied by our vendors = new digital temperature compensation hardware

    Fine tuning = getting the new hardware to work without getting E errors

    Valentine Research has said many times in email and phone conversations that the 3.85x versions have no improved performance over 3.826 - and that it would be a waste of time to "upgrade".
